What Is Strawberry Lassi?
Lassi is a traditional Indian drink made with yogurt, water, and spices or sweeteners. It has been enjoyed for centuries across the Indian subcontinent as a cooling beverage, especially during the hot summer months.
A strawberry lassi is a fruit lassi variation that includes fresh strawberries, making it a perfect blend of sweet and tangy flavors. This Indian yogurt-based drink is often served chilled and can be sweetened with honey or maple syrup for a natural touch.

Ingredients Needed for Strawberry Lassi
To make this strawberry lassi, you’ll need:
- Fresh strawberries (or frozen strawberries) – 1 cup
- Plain yogurt (or Greek yogurt) – 1 cup
- Ice cubes or crushed ice – ½ cup
- Sweetener (honey, maple syrup, or sugar) – 2 tbsp
- Cardamom (optional, for a warm spice note) – ¼ tsp
- Rose water (optional, for floral aroma) – ½ tsp
- Mint leaves (for garnish)
How to Make This Strawberry Lassi at Home
Making this delicious lassi is super simple! Follow these steps:
- Prepare the strawberries – Wash and remove the stems. If using frozen strawberries, let them thaw slightly.
- Blend – Add all the ingredients (strawberries, yogurt, ice cubes, sweetener, and cardamom) into a blender.
- Blend until smooth and frothy – This should take about 30–60 seconds.
- Taste and adjust – If needed, add more sweetener or a splash of rose water.
- Chill and serve – Pour into a glass, garnish with sliced strawberries or mint leaves, and enjoy!
Variations: Sweet Lassi vs. Salt Lassi
Sweet Lassi
- Made with honey, sugar, or maple syrup
- Often flavored with rose water, cardamom, or fruit puree
- Served cold with ice cubes
Salt Lassi
- Made with salt instead of sugar
- Sometimes includes cumin powder for an earthy taste
- More common in Indian restaurants
Both versions are yogurt-based drinks that are believed to aid digestion.

Tips for a Perfect, Frothy Strawberry Lassi
- Use full-fat yogurt for a rich and creamy texture.
- Make sure to use chilled yogurt to keep the drink refreshing.
- Blend on high speed for a frothy consistency.
- Using fresh strawberries will give the best flavor, but frozen strawberries work too.
- If the lassi is too thick, add a splash of milk or water.
Storing and Freezing Strawberry Lassi
- Fridge – Store in an airtight bottle for up to 24 hours. Shake well before drinking.
- Freezer – Freeze in ice cube trays and blend again when ready to serve.

What Yogurt to Use for Lassi?
The best yogurt for lassi is plain, full-fat yogurt because it provides a rich and creamy texture. You can also use Greek yogurt for a thicker consistency or homemade yogurt for a more traditional taste. If you prefer a lighter version, low-fat or dairy-free yogurt can be used as well.
